Subject: Siftgate cut-over summary

Plugin authors,

As of this morning, all reads against the Corvane key-value store pass through the Siftgate bloom filter layer. Negative lookups now short-circuit before hitting storage, so expect lower tail latencies but slightly different miss semantics. Please retest any caching plugins against the new layer using the parameters below.

settings of yahig-baweg:
[istael]
host = istael.qorvellabs.corp
user = istael_svc
database = istael_prod

## Service Accounts — StormFan Alert Fan-Out

The fan-out worker authenticates to the internal dispatch tier using the svc-stormfan account. Rotate quarterly; scopes are limited to publish-only on alert topics. If deliveries stall during your shift, verify the worker is using the current credential, reproduced below for reference.

API key for kaweg-hahif: kto4_rAjZ

Finance Review Summary – Warranty Cost Overrun

Warranty expenses for the Trellick V4 pump line exceeded the provisioned amount by 38% this quarter, driven primarily by seal failures traced to a supplier batch from the Dovermoor plant. Accruals have been restated, and a revised provision methodology is under review with the controller's office. Supplier recovery negotiations are ongoing. The following note provides context for forward planning.

confidential, kagup-bafog: Fraaxax Group is in early talks to buy Soroxox Group for about $343.8 million. The Olidor launch date is June 14, and nothing goes to the press before then. Legal wants the Aldmirek Logistics term sheet signed before July 23.

Handover note for security review: I'm transferring the Marrowline per-tenant rate quota service to Ines. Quotas are enforced at the gateway, counted per tenant per minute, with a burst allowance on top. Overrides for premium tenants live in a separate table and expire automatically. Nothing bypasses the limiter except internal health checks. The enforcement thresholds currently in production are set to the following values.

settings of tagef-bawif:
DRUIX_HOST=druix.zemvarlabs.internal
DRUIX_PORT=8000